YAMA Cast Season 2 Episode 1: The one about transfers

Tansfers. It’s all anyone wants to know about these days. Forget for a moment that the season kicks off one week from today – it’s all about who’s coming in. That’s why we’re happy to kick off season 2 with a one on one discussion with one of the folks most Gooners online turn to for their transfer stories – @GeoffArsenal.
I don’t know Geoff’s last name – never asked but he is usually one of the first people to have information on Arsenal transformations and I would classify his success rate as near on 95%. When you ask anyone on social media who you should trust on rumours – it’s always Geoff’s name that comes up first.
Geoff and I spend 30+ minutes going through the whole Luis Suarez saga and what the likely outcome could be. We also discuss the rumour dujour which is the one rumour that has been perculating out there but is now gaining more traction – Bayern Munich’s Gustavo to Arsenal for a fee of around £14 million. Gustavo finds himself the odd man out in Pep Guardiola’s German plans and has been left out of their most recent match.
Originally reported to going to Wolfsburg that story seems to have been muted. Geoff talks briefly and whether or not Arsenal are truly in for the player. We also take a look at the need for defensive cover and whether or not Arsenal will be bringing in a RB or CB to fill in for the missing players.
